### Symbolism and Meaning
Geckos are often seen as symbols of:
* **Adaptability:** Their ability to thrive in diverse environments makes them emblems of resilience and adaptability.
* **Regeneration:** Geckos can detach their tails as a defense mechanism, which then regrows, representing renewal and rebirth.
* **Good Luck:** In many cultures, geckos are considered bringers of good fortune and prosperity.
* **Protection:** They are sometimes seen as guardians against negative energies.
These symbolic meanings can be incorporated into your gecko tattoo design, adding a deeper layer of personal significance. Based on expert consensus, the symbolism of the gecko often resonates with individuals seeking a tattoo that represents strength and perseverance.

## Choosing the Right Placement for Your Gecko Tattoo
The placement of your gecko tattoo is just as important as the design itself. Consider the size, shape, and style of your tattoo when choosing a location on your body. Here are some popular placement options:
### Back
The back provides a large canvas for elaborate gecko tattoos. This is a great choice for those who want a detailed design that spans a significant portion of their body. A full back piece can tell a story or showcase a complex composition.
### Shoulder
The shoulder is a versatile placement option that can accommodate both small and large gecko tattoos. It’s a visible location that can be easily shown off or covered up, depending on your preference.
### Arm
The arm is a popular choice for gecko tattoos, offering a variety of placement options, from the upper arm to the forearm. This location allows for a dynamic display of the tattoo, especially with arm movements.
### Leg
The leg is another versatile placement option, with the calf and thigh being popular choices. Leg tattoos can be easily concealed or revealed, depending on your style and preference.
### Ankle
The ankle is a subtle and discreet placement option for smaller gecko tattoos. It’s a great choice for those who prefer a more understated look.
### Rib Cage
The rib cage is a sensual and personal placement option. It can be a more painful area to tattoo due to the proximity of bone, but the result can be stunning. This placement is often chosen for more intimate designs.
### Foot
The foot is a less common but still viable placement option for small gecko tattoos. It’s a good choice for those who want a hidden tattoo that can be easily shown off when desired. Keep in mind that foot tattoos can fade more quickly due to friction from shoes and socks.
## Finding Free Gecko Tattoo Designs: Resources and Considerations
Finding free gecko tattoo designs online is easy, but it’s important to consider the following:
* **Copyright:** Be aware that many designs are copyrighted. Using a copyrighted design without permission can lead to legal issues. It is always best to adapt a design you find online to make it your own or have an artist create a custom design for you.
* **Quality:** Free designs may not be of the highest quality. Look for designs that are clear, well-defined, and professionally drawn. Pixelated or poorly drawn designs will not translate well into a tattoo.
* **Originality:** Consider the originality of the design. A free design that is widely available may not be as unique or personal as a custom design. Adapting free designs is highly recommended.

## Aftercare: Protecting Your New Gecko Tattoo
Proper aftercare is essential for ensuring that your new gecko tattoo heals properly and looks its best. Here are some general aftercare guidelines:
* **Keep it Clean:** Wash your tattoo gently with mild soap and water several times a day. Avoid using harsh soaps or scrubbing the tattoo.
* **Moisturize:** Apply a thin layer of fragrance-free lotion to your tattoo several times a day to keep it moisturized. Avoid using petroleum-based products, as they can clog the pores.
* **Avoid Sun Exposure:** Protect your tattoo from direct sunlight, as it can cause fading and damage. Wear loose-fitting clothing or apply sunscreen to the tattoo when you are outdoors.
* **Don’t Pick or Scratch:** Avoid picking or scratching your tattoo, as this can lead to infection and scarring. Let the tattoo heal naturally.
* **Follow Your Artist’s Instructions:** Your tattoo artist will provide you with specific aftercare instructions. Follow these instructions carefully to ensure the best possible results.

4. **How do different skin tones affect the appearance of gecko tattoo colors?** *Answer:* Lighter skin tones generally allow colors to appear more vibrant, while darker skin tones may require bolder, more saturated colors to ensure visibility. Consult with your artist about choosing colors that will complement your skin tone.
5. **What are the long-term care considerations for maintaining the vibrancy of a gecko tattoo?** *Answer:* Sun protection is crucial for preventing fading. Apply sunscreen regularly to your tattoo, especially during prolonged sun exposure. Also, keep the skin moisturized to prevent dryness and cracking.
6. **How can I incorporate personal symbolism into my gecko tattoo design?** *Answer:* Consider adding elements that represent your personal values, beliefs, or experiences. This could include incorporating specific colors, symbols, or quotes that are meaningful to you. Discuss these ideas with your artist to create a truly unique and personal design.
7. **What are the cultural sensitivities I should be aware of when choosing a tribal or Polynesian gecko tattoo design?** *Answer:* It’s essential to research the cultural significance of the symbols and patterns used in tribal or Polynesian designs. Avoid appropriating or misrepresenting these symbols. If possible, consult with someone from the culture to ensure that your design is respectful and accurate.
8. **What are the signs of a poorly executed gecko tattoo, and how can I avoid them?** *Answer:* Signs of a poorly executed tattoo include blurry lines, uneven shading, and inconsistent color saturation. To avoid these issues, choose a reputable artist with a strong portfolio and a proven track record. Don’t be afraid to ask questions and express your concerns.
9. **How often should I moisturize my gecko tattoo, and what type of lotion is best?** *Answer:* Moisturize your tattoo several times a day, especially during the initial healing process. Use a fragrance-free, hypoallergenic lotion specifically designed for tattoo aftercare. Avoid petroleum-based products, as they can clog the pores.
10. **What should I do if my gecko tattoo becomes infected?** *Answer:* If you suspect that your tattoo is infected, consult a doctor immediately. Signs of infection include redness, swelling, pain, pus, and fever. Do not attempt to treat the infection yourself.
